In Pittsburgh’s shadows, where hope felt thin, On 7th and Carson, where life would begin, You found us, Keee and Boob, broken yet whole, Your presence, Ella, a calm to the soul. Under the bridge, amidst chaos and strife, We fought for survival, for a glimpse of life. Overdoses claimed many, the darkness was near, But angelic hearts, like yours, appeared. At 2nd and Bates, where peace took its place, You sang us songs that felt like grace. Your guitar spoke truths, raw and unplanned, A voice from heaven in this broken land. Each note you played, each word you shared, Brought comfort to souls who thought no one cared. I saw my daughter in the way you’d play, Her spirit alive, though she’s far away. Oh Ella, dear Ella, if you only knew, The worth and light that God sees in you. In every trial, in pain or despair, His love surrounds you, always there. You are His masterpiece, a radiant flame, A child of grace, called by name. Though the roads may lead me far from your side, Gods Spirit connects us, our hearts intertwined. The love you showed in those darkest nights, Is etched in my soul, a beacon of light. Pittsburgh held hell, but it also held you, An angel among us, with a heart so true. If paths should cross again, I’ll rejoice in that day, But until then, in His love, we’ll stay. Your kindness, your strength, your unyielding care, Reminds me that God’s love is always there. Hes there, right there, Hes here, in here, in there, in there, with me, with you! Look, see, He, is with you too! All Glory to God as I Thank you! Thank you!
